Brandon S. Yeaton, obituary
CUSHING — Brandon S. Yeaton, 32, died unexpectedly, Friday, October 6, 2023 at his home.
Born in Brunswick, September 3, 1991, he was the son of Roberta Olson and Bradley Yeaton. Educated locally, he was a 2010 graduate of Georges Valley High School. While in high school he participated in Soccer and Basketball.
From a young age, Brandon loved being on the water. He was proud to have purchased his own lobster boat, naming it after his beloved niece, Peyton Amy. He was a hard worker and an excellent fisherman.
A gentle soul, he had a special place in his heart for animals, especially his two dogs. Most important in his life were his friends and family. He loved nothing more than being together with them and spending time laughing and joking.
He will be sadly missed by all who knew him.
Predeceased by his brother Heath Yeaton; Brandon is survived by his parents, Roberta and Bradley of Cushing; his brothers Jeremey Yeaton and his fiancée Jasmine Doughty of Friendship, Travis Eaton and his wife Stacy of Waldoboro; many special aunts, uncles and cousins, several special life-long friends and too many more friends to count.
